Just got back from my doctor's appointment to get the results from my latest CT scan. I am still stable, so the news is all good! Yeah Iressa! However, (isn't there always a however?) I told the doc that I have had a headache in the same area of my head every day for about 2 1/2 weeks now, so he thought it would be good to get a MRI of the brain just to be on the safe side. He said it would be highly unusual to have stable everything in the lungs and have something pop up in the brain, but we need to check it since it is a new symptom. I personally think it is hormonal.

Anyway, glad to be able to post some good news!

Celebrate the great news from the CT scan. For the most part of the past 22 months, I have been on either Iressa or Tarceva (the sister drug to Iressa). I have had periods where I would headaches daily for several days. At the time, I knew it was not my brain since I was (and still am) having regular MRIs. The nurses told me that headaches were not unheard of as a side effect (although it may not be common). In addition, there were periods of time where the the top of my head just hurt. The drug changed my natural hair part. In addition, prior to any treatment, I had alot of perfectly straight hair. I now have alot of thick curly hair. My hairdresser never knows what to expect when I come in. I found that I feel the best when I keep my water consumption up.

Here's to continued success with the drug.
